Top 5 Arcade Racing Apps in Paraguay Q4 2021

In the fourth quarter of 2021, Paraguay saw notable performances from the top 5 arcade racing applications on a unified platform. These insights are based on data from Sensor Tower.

Need for Speed No Limits by Electronic Arts showed a consistent pattern in both revenue and downloads. Weekly revenue fluctuated, peaking at $150 in both the first week of November and the third week of December. Downloads remained stable, with a slight increase towards the end of the quarter, reaching approximately 1.3K in the final week.

Asphalt Legends Unite from Gameloft experienced a significant surge in revenue, particularly in the week of November 22, where it spiked to $229. Weekly downloads also saw a steady rise, culminating in just over 1K by the end of December.

Asphalt 8: Airborne, another title from Gameloft, maintained stable weekly revenue, hovering around $50-$60 throughout the quarter. Downloads exhibited a slight decline mid-quarter, but the app still garnered over 1.3K downloads in the final week of December.

Need for Speed™ Most Wanted also by Electronic Arts, showed modest revenue figures, peaking at $66 in the final week of the year. Downloads were minimal, with only minor fluctuations throughout the quarter.

Finally, Thomas & Friends: Go Go Thomas by Budge Studios demonstrated a steady revenue stream, reaching $60 in the week of November 22. However, downloads exhibited a downward trend, ending at 108 in the last week of December.
